A sensible methodology exists for estimating the periodic value related to leasing an asset. This calculation usually includes a number of key variables: the capitalized value of the asset (its preliminary worth), the residual worth (its projected worth on the finish of the lease time period), the lease time period (length of the lease), and the rate of interest (or cash issue) utilized to the lease. A simplified method combines the depreciation price (the distinction between the capitalized value and the residual worth, divided by the lease time period) with the finance cost (calculated by multiplying the typical of the capitalized value and the residual worth by the cash issue). The ensuing sum offers an approximation of the quantity due every month.

1. Capitalized Value

Capitalized value is a foundational aspect in figuring out the periodic obligation inside a lease settlement. It straight influences the depreciation part and, consequently, the general month-to-month fee. Understanding its composition and potential for negotiation is essential for lessees.

  • Preliminary Worth of the Asset

    The capitalized value represents the agreed-upon worth of the asset on the inception of the lease. This determine, usually negotiable, can embrace the producer’s prompt retail worth (MSRP), seller markups, and related charges. Decreasing the capitalized value straight reduces the depreciation quantity calculated within the fee system, lowering the month-to-month expense. For instance, negotiating a reduction on the MSRP previous to finalizing the lease settlement will result in a smaller capitalized value and, thus, a decrease month-to-month fee.

  • Influence on Depreciation

    The depreciation portion of the month-to-month fee is derived from the distinction between the capitalized value and the residual worth (the asset’s estimated worth on the lease’s finish), divided by the lease time period. A better capitalized value, with a set residual worth and lease time period, leads to a bigger depreciation expense every month. Due to this fact, understanding the elements that contribute to the capitalized value is crucial to controlling this good portion of the month-to-month fee.

  • Inclusion of Charges and Expenses

    The capitalized value can incorporate varied charges and fees, similar to acquisition charges, documentation charges, and even prolonged warranties. These add-ons improve the overall capitalized value and, consequently, the month-to-month lease fee. Lessees ought to scrutinize these charges, understanding what they characterize and whether or not they are often negotiated or eradicated to scale back the general value of the lease.

  • Capitalized Value Reductions

    Capitalized value reductions, similar to money down funds or trade-in allowances, straight lower the capitalized value, leading to a decrease month-to-month fee. Whereas a down fee reduces the month-to-month obligation, it additionally represents an upfront expense and probably a lack of capital if the car is totaled. Evaluating the long-term monetary implications of capitalized value reductions is essential for making an knowledgeable resolution.

2. Residual Worth

Residual worth constitutes a basic determinant in calculating the month-to-month lease fee. It represents the estimated price of the leased asset on the conclusion of the lease time period, straight impacting the depreciation part of the periodic fee.

  • Definition and Calculation Influence

    Residual worth is the projected market worth of the asset on the finish of the lease interval, as decided by the leasing firm. A better residual worth interprets to a decrease depreciation expense, because the lessee is barely accountable for paying the distinction between the capitalized value (preliminary worth) and the residual worth over the lease time period. For instance, if a car has a capitalized value of $30,000 and a residual worth of $15,000 after three years, the overall depreciation is $15,000, which is then divided by the lease time period to calculate the month-to-month depreciation expense. A better residual worth on this state of affairs would straight cut back this month-to-month quantity.

  • Components Influencing Residual Worth

    A number of elements affect the willpower of residual worth, together with the make and mannequin of the asset, projected market circumstances, anticipated mileage, and the general situation of the asset on the finish of the lease. Automobiles with robust model reputations and traditionally excessive resale values usually have greater residual values. Conversely, fashions recognized for fast depreciation or excessive upkeep prices are inclined to have decrease residual values. Leasing firms make the most of statistical fashions and market evaluation to foretell these values precisely.

  • Lease-Finish Choices

    The residual worth is essential on the finish of the lease, because it types the idea for the lessee’s buy possibility. If the lessee decides to buy the asset on the finish of the lease time period, the acquisition worth is usually equal to the predetermined residual worth. A better residual worth might discourage the lessee from buying the asset if the market worth is decrease. Conversely, a decrease residual worth would possibly make the acquisition possibility extra enticing. Due to this fact, an correct evaluation of residual worth advantages each the leasing firm and the lessee.

  • Influence on Monetary Planning

    Understanding the residual worth permits lessees to higher anticipate end-of-lease monetary obligations. This contains assessing whether or not buying the asset is a financially sound resolution or whether or not returning the asset and getting into into a brand new lease is extra advantageous. Data of the residual worth additionally facilitates comparability of various lease presents, enabling lessees to decide on choices with favorable phrases that align with their long-term monetary objectives.

3. Lease Time period

The length of the lease settlement, referred to as the lease time period, is an important variable straight influencing the periodic fee calculation. Its impression is primarily manifested by way of its impact on the depreciation expense and the overall curiosity paid over the lifetime of the lease.

  • Influence on Month-to-month Depreciation Expense

    The lease time period determines the interval over which the asset’s depreciation is distributed. A shorter lease time period leads to a better month-to-month depreciation expense, because the distinction between the capitalized value and the residual worth is amortized over a fewer variety of funds. Conversely, an extended lease time period spreads the depreciation over extra months, resulting in a decrease month-to-month expense. As an example, leasing a car with a capitalized value of $30,000 and a residual worth of $15,000 would end in a month-to-month depreciation of $625 over a 24-month lease, whereas a 36-month lease would cut back the month-to-month depreciation to $416.67.

  • Complete Curiosity Paid over the Lease

    Whereas an extended lease time period lowers the month-to-month fee, it usually will increase the overall quantity of curiosity paid over the course of the settlement. The finance cost, calculated utilizing the cash issue, is utilized to the typical of the capitalized value and the residual worth for every month of the lease. Extending the lease time period implies that this curiosity cost is utilized for a larger variety of months, leading to a better general curiosity expense. Due to this fact, people ought to rigorously consider the trade-off between decrease month-to-month funds and elevated long-term curiosity prices.

  • Flexibility and Finish-of-Lease Choices

    The lease time period additionally influences the lessee’s flexibility and end-of-lease choices. Shorter lease phrases present larger flexibility, as lessees can extra rapidly transition to a more recent asset or completely different car. Nonetheless, longer lease phrases might supply extra favorable month-to-month funds, which will be useful for people looking for finances predictability. On the finish of the lease, the lessee has the choice to buy the asset on the predetermined residual worth, return the asset, or probably prolong the lease. The selection is usually influenced by the unique lease time period and the lessee’s altering wants.

  • Relationship to Residual Worth

    The lease time period is intricately linked to the residual worth. The longer the lease time period, the decrease the anticipated residual worth, because the asset is predicted to depreciate additional over an prolonged interval. This interaction between the lease time period and the residual worth considerably impacts the depreciation expense portion of the month-to-month lease fee. Leasing firms rigorously analyze these elements when structuring lease agreements to reduce their danger and maximize profitability.

4. Cash Issue

The cash issue, although seemingly insignificant in magnitude, performs an important position in figuring out the overall value of a lease settlement. It represents the rate of interest part inside a lease. The cash issue, generally known as the lease issue, is multiplied by the sum of the capitalized value and the residual worth, offering the finance cost. This cost is then included within the lessee’s month-to-month fee. An understanding of the cash issue’s affect is crucial for successfully assessing the true value of leasing. For instance, a cash issue of 0.002 might seem inconsequential, however when utilized to a capitalized value of $30,000 and a residual worth of $20,000, it leads to a major finance cost integrated into the month-to-month fee.

The simplified calculation method aggregates the depreciation expense (the distinction between capitalized value and residual worth, divided by the lease time period) with the finance cost, which is predicated on the cash issue. As a result of the cash issue straight influences the finance cost, understanding its worth allows a lessee to estimate and examine the general value of various lease choices. A decrease cash issue interprets to a decrease finance cost and consequently, a decrease month-to-month fee, all different variables being equal. Conversely, a better cash issue will increase the finance cost and the month-to-month fee. Dealerships might current the cash issue in several codecs, requiring customers to transform it to an equal annual proportion price (APR) for comparability with mortgage rates of interest. This conversion is usually achieved by multiplying the cash issue by 2400.

5. Depreciation Payment

The depreciation price, a key part throughout the simplified methodology for approximating a month-to-month lease obligation, represents the discount within the asset’s worth over the length of the lease. Its calculation includes subtracting the residual worth (the asset’s projected price at lease termination) from the capitalized value (the preliminary worth) and dividing the consequence by the variety of months within the lease time period. Consequently, the depreciation price straight influences the magnitude of the month-to-month fee. As an example, an asset with a capitalized value of $40,000 and a residual worth of $20,000 leased for 36 months yields a depreciation price of $555.56 per 30 days. This quantity constitutes a good portion of the overall month-to-month obligation, emphasizing its significance in understanding lease economics.

A sensible consequence of a better depreciation price is an elevated month-to-month lease fee. That is primarily because of the lessee successfully paying for the asset’s worth decline throughout their utilization. Conversely, a decrease depreciation price, usually ensuing from a better residual worth or a decrease capitalized value, interprets to a decreased month-to-month fee. Leasing firms make the most of refined algorithms to estimate residual values precisely, as an overestimation can result in losses if the asset is price lower than projected at lease finish. Lessees can affect the depreciation price by negotiating the capitalized value or choosing property with traditionally robust residual values. Moreover, understanding this relationship permits lessees to match completely different lease presents, contemplating not solely the month-to-month fee but additionally the underlying depreciation expense.

6. Finance Cost

The finance cost is a essential aspect in calculating the month-to-month lease fee, and its integration into the simplified system is paramount. This cost represents the price of borrowing funds over the lease time period and straight impacts the overall expense incurred by the lessee. Inside the simplified system, the finance cost is usually calculated by multiplying the typical of the capitalized value (the preliminary worth of the asset) and the residual worth (the asset’s projected worth at lease finish) by the cash issue (a decimal illustration of the rate of interest). The ensuing product is then added to the depreciation price to find out the overall month-to-month obligation. Due to this fact, the finance cost is a non-negligible part contributing to the ultimate determine paid by the lessee every month.

For instance, think about a state of affairs the place the capitalized value of a car is $30,000, the residual worth is $15,000, and the cash issue is 0.0025. The common of the capitalized value and residual worth is $22,500. Multiplying this common by the cash issue yields a finance cost of $56.25 per 30 days. This $56.25 is then added to the depreciation expense (calculated because the distinction between capitalized value and residual worth divided by the lease time period) to reach on the complete month-to-month lease fee. A better cash issue would straight improve the finance cost, resulting in a correspondingly greater month-to-month fee. Due to this fact, cautious consideration of the finance cost, particularly the cash issue, is crucial for evaluating completely different lease presents and understanding the true value of leasing.

7. Month-to-month Obligation

The month-to-month obligation represents the overall periodic fee required underneath a lease settlement, and it’s the direct results of the simplified system. The system integrates key monetary variables to estimate this fee. Alterations in any of those variables straight have an effect on the magnitude of the month-to-month obligation. The month-to-month obligation contains the depreciation price (reflecting the asset’s worth decline) and the finance cost (the price of financing the asset). Understanding how these elements collectively contribute to the general month-to-month obligation is essential for efficient finances administration and monetary planning. For instance, if the capitalized value is decreased by way of negotiation, the month-to-month obligation will consequently lower. Equally, a better residual worth, leading to a decrease depreciation price, additionally reduces the month-to-month fee. Conversely, will increase within the cash issue elevate the finance cost, driving up the month-to-month obligation.

The month-to-month obligation serves as an important benchmark for evaluating varied lease choices. A decrease month-to-month obligation might seem enticing, however a complete evaluation necessitates inspecting the underlying elements. For instance, a decrease month-to-month fee may be achieved by way of an extended lease time period; nonetheless, this extension might result in a better complete value over the lease’s length attributable to elevated finance fees. Contemplate two lease choices for a similar car: Choice A presents a month-to-month obligation of $400 over 36 months, whereas Choice B presents $350 over 48 months. Though Choice B presents a decrease month-to-month fee, the overall value over the lease time period is $16,800, in comparison with $14,400 for Choice A. A transparent understanding of the month-to-month obligation, mixed with data of the system’s variables, allows customers to make knowledgeable choices aligning with their monetary targets.

Methods for Optimizing Lease Phrases

Maximizing the advantages and minimizing the prices related to lease agreements requires strategic negotiation and an intensive understanding of the elements influencing the month-to-month obligation. The next suggestions present steerage on leverage data of the calculation methodology to realize favorable lease phrases.

Tip 1: Negotiate the Capitalized Value Aggressively: The capitalized value is the inspiration upon which the lease fee is constructed. Negotiating this determine downward straight reduces the month-to-month depreciation expense and, consequently, the month-to-month fee. Analysis market values, leverage aggressive presents, and be ready to stroll away if the preliminary supply is unfavorable.

Tip 2: Scrutinize Charges and Expenses Included within the Capitalized Value: Dealerships usually embrace varied charges and fees throughout the capitalized value, similar to acquisition charges, documentation charges, and prolonged warranties. Query these charges and try to barter them down or get rid of them fully. Decreasing these add-ons can considerably decrease the capitalized value.

Tip 3: Perceive the Cash Issue and Convert it to an APR: The cash issue represents the rate of interest part of the lease. Multiply the cash issue by 2400 to acquire an approximate annual proportion price (APR) for comparability with mortgage rates of interest. A decrease cash issue interprets to a decrease finance cost and a decreased month-to-month fee.

Tip 4: Examine Lease Affords from A number of Dealerships: Don’t accept the primary lease supply acquired. Acquire quotes from a number of dealerships to leverage aggressive pricing. Completely different dealerships might supply various capitalized prices, residual values, and cash elements. A complete comparability reveals essentially the most advantageous phrases.

Tip 5: Consider the Influence of Capitalized Value Reductions Rigorously: Money down funds or trade-in allowances cut back the capitalized value, decreasing the month-to-month fee. Nonetheless, weigh the upfront expense in opposition to the long-term financial savings. Contemplate whether or not the capital could possibly be invested extra profitably elsewhere.

Tip 6: Contemplate Shorter Lease Phrases for Flexibility: Whereas longer lease phrases might end in decrease month-to-month funds, in addition they improve the overall curiosity paid and cut back flexibility. Shorter lease phrases enable for extra frequent transitions to newer property and probably reduce the danger of being locked right into a depreciating asset.

Tip 7: Know the Projected Residual Worth and Plan Accordingly: The residual worth influences the depreciation expense and the end-of-lease choices. If contemplating buying the asset at lease finish, examine the residual worth to its projected market worth. A decrease residual worth might make buying the asset extra enticing.
